BARNSTABLE, Mass. — A 43-year-old man was arrested Sunday after police say he struck a Barnstable police officer while driving under the influence following a ZZ Top concert.

The officer was struck around 10:05 p.m. at 41 West Main St. in Hyannis while assisting with pedestrian traffic after the concert at the Cape Cod Melody Tent, according to police. The officer was wearing a bright-colored, reflective jacket and holding a flashlight while standing in an illuminated crosswalk equipped with flashing lights when a car heading eastbound on West Main Street entered the crosswalk and struck them.

Other officers and tent staff provided aid before the officer was taken to Cape Cod Hospital for treatment. The extent of the officer’s injuries has not been disclosed.

Police identified the driver as a 43-year-old Osterville man and said investigators developed probable cause to believe he was driving under the influence of alcohol. Officers arrested the man, whose name has not been released, and charged him with operating under the influence of liquor, second offense; operating under the influence of liquor causing serious injury through negligence; and negligent operation of a motor vehicle.

The man is scheduled to be arraigned in Barnstable District Court on Monday.
